    Getting Started with ComSwap: A Step-by-Step Setup for Beginners

    What is ComSwap (brief)

    ComSwap is a peer-to-peer token swap platform that lets users exchange cryptocurrencies directly, often via community-run liquidity pools or smart contracts. This guide assumes you want a secure, simple setup to start swapping tokens.

    1. Prepare a Web3 Wallet

    1. Choose a wallet: MetaMask (browser/mobile) or a hardware wallet (Ledger, Trezor) for higher security.
    2. Install and initialize: create a new wallet, write down the seed phrase offline, and set a strong password.
    3. Fund your wallet: buy or transfer a small amount of the network’s native token (e.g., ETH for Ethereum-based ComSwap) to cover swap fees.

    2. Connect to the Correct Network

    1. Confirm which blockchain ComSwap runs on (e.g., Ethereum, BSC, Polygon).
    2. In your wallet, add/select that network. For custom networks, enter RPC URL, chain ID, symbol, and block explorer URL if required.

    3. Verify the Official ComSwap Interface

    1. Use the official ComSwap URL from a trusted source (project website, verified social profiles).
    2. Check for HTTPS and correct domain. Avoid links from unknown posts.
    3. Optionally, bookmark the official site and access it only from that bookmark.

    4. Approve Token Permissions Safely

    1. When swapping, you’ll often be asked to “approve” a token. Approvals let the contract move specific tokens from your wallet.
    2. Use “Approve once” or set low allowance if available. For recurring use, consider using a maximum only with trusted contracts.
    3. Revoke unnecessary approvals later via wallet or third-party revocation tools.

    5. Execute Your First Swap

    1. Select the token pair and enter the amount to swap.
    2. Review estimated rates, slippage tolerance, minimum received, and fees. Set slippage tolerance low (e.g., 0.5–1%) unless the token is illiquid.
    3. Confirm the transaction in your wallet and pay the network fee. Wait for confirmation on-chain.

    6. Confirm and Track the Transaction

    1. Copy the transaction hash from your wallet and paste it into a blockchain explorer (Etherscan, etc.) to monitor status.
    2. If the swap fails, check error messages, gas price, or token contract issues. Failed transactions still incur gas.

    7. Post-Swap Safety Steps

    • Check balances: Ensure tokens appear in your wallet; add custom token contract if needed.
    • Revoke approvals: Remove token allowances you no longer need.
    • Use small test swaps: For new tokens or pools, swap a small amount first.

    8. Advanced: Using a Hardware Wallet

    1. Connect Ledger/Trezor to MetaMask or supported DApp connector.
    2. Approve each transaction physically on the device for improved security.

    9. Troubleshooting & Tips

    • High gas fees: Try different times or use alternative networks if supported.
    • Slippage/timeouts: Increase slippage carefully or extend transaction deadline if needed.
    • Scams/imitations: Never share your seed phrase or private keys. Verify contracts on explorers.

    Quick Checklist (before swapping)

    • Wallet set up and seeded with native token for fees
    • Correct network selected
    • Official ComSwap site verified
    • Token approvals reviewed and minimized
    • Small test swap completed successfully

  • MapConverter — Batch Convert Maps Between Any Format

    MapConverter is a tool designed to batch convert maps between various formats. This utility is particularly useful for users who work with geographic information systems (GIS), mapping, or geospatial data and need to convert their map files from one format to another.

    Key Features:

    • Format Compatibility: MapConverter supports a wide range of map and geospatial file formats. This can include but is not limited to, ESRI’s Shapefiles (.shp), GeoJSON, KML (Keyhole Markup Language), GeoTIFF, and others. The exact formats supported can depend on the specific version and configuration of MapConverter.

    • Batch Conversion: One of the main advantages of MapConverter is its ability to handle batch conversions. This means users can convert multiple files at once, saving time and effort compared to converting files one by one.

    • User Interface and Ease of Use: Typically, MapConverter offers a user-friendly interface that makes it accessible to users with varying levels of technical expertise. This can include drag-and-drop functionality for adding files, straightforward selection of input and output formats, and clear instructions or tooltips for each step of the process.

    • Customization and Options: Depending on the tool, users might have options to customize the conversion process. This could involve setting coordinate reference systems (CRS), choosing which attributes to include or exclude from the conversion, and handling of spatial indexes.

    • Integration and Compatibility: Some versions or related tools might offer integration with other GIS software or platforms, allowing for seamless workflow integration.

    Use Cases:

    • GIS Professionals: For professionals working with GIS, MapConverter can be an essential tool for data preparation and conversion, enabling them to work with data in the format required by their software or project.

    • Cartographers and Researchers: Those involved in mapping projects or spatial analysis might use MapConverter to ensure their data is in the correct format for analysis or publication.

    • Developers: Developers working on location-based services or applications might use MapConverter to convert and prepare map data for use in their applications.

    How It Works:

    1. File Selection: Users select the map files they want to convert. This can often be done through a file dialog or by dragging and dropping files into the application.

    2. Format Selection: Users choose the original format of their files and the format they want to convert to.

    3. Options and Customization: If available, users can select any conversion options, such as the CRS or data attributes to include.

    4. Conversion: The user initiates the conversion process. Depending on the tool and the number of files, this might take a few moments or several minutes.

    5. Output: Converted files are saved to a location specified by the user.

    Transfer Contacts: Import VCF Files into MS Outlook

    Overview

    Importing VCF (vCard) files into Microsoft Outlook moves contact details (names, emails, phone numbers, addresses, photos, notes) from other apps or devices into Outlook so you can manage them there.

    Methods (quick summary)

    1. Direct double-click / Open (single vCard) — Windows recognizes .vcf; opening a vCard lets you save it to Outlook one contact at a time.
    2. Import via Outlook (multiple vCards) — Use Outlook’s Import/Export wizard or drag multiple .vcf files into the People/Contacts view.
    3. Convert to CSV then import — When you have many vCards or apps export multi-contact VCFs incompatible with Outlook, convert to CSV mapping fields and use Outlook’s CSV import.
    4. Use Windows Contacts as intermediary — Import .vcf into Windows Contacts, then export as CSV for Outlook.
    5. Third‑party tools — Paid/free converters can batch-convert complex or large multi-contact VCFs to Outlook-compatible formats.

    Step-by-step: Common approaches

    Single or few vCard files (Outlook desktop)
    1. Save the .vcf file(s) to your PC.
    2. Double-click a .vcf file; it opens in the Contacts viewer.
    3. Click Save & Close (or Save). The contact is added to Outlook Contacts.
    • To add multiple at once: select multiple .vcf files in File Explorer and drag them into Outlook’s Contacts/People window.
    Import multiple vCards via Import/Export (when available)
    1. In Outlook, go to File > Open & Export > Import/Export.
    2. Choose Import a VCARD file (.vcf) or import from file (may vary by Outlook version). Follow prompts.
      (Note: Some Outlook versions don’t import multi-contact .vcf files directly.)
    Convert multi-contact VCF to CSV (recommended for large sets)
    1. Use an online converter or Windows Contacts:
      • Open Windows Contacts (type “Contacts” in Start), choose Import, select vCard (VCF) and import files.
      • Then choose Export > CSV (Comma Separated) and export.
    2. In Outlook: File > Open & Export > Import/Export > Import from another program or file > Comma Separated Values, map fields, and finish.

    Field mapping and issues to watch

    • Map vCard fields (e.g., FN, TEL, EMAIL) to Outlook fields during CSV import.
    • Photos and custom fields may be lost in CSV conversion.
    • Multi-contact .vcf files may be treated as a single entry — convert to individual vCards first.
    • Character encoding: use UTF-8 for non‑ASCII characters to avoid garbled names.

    Troubleshooting

    • If contacts don’t appear, check you imported into the correct Contacts folder/account.
    • Use a small test import to verify field mapping before bulk import.
    • For duplicates, use Outlook’s duplicate handling options or clean up afterward.

    When to use third‑party tools

    • Large exports (hundreds/thousands)
    • Complex vCards with photos, multiple phone types, custom fields
    • Need automated de-duplication or batch processing
